By Twink Jones Gadama
In a heartwarming display of community spirit, George Isaac, a renowned tailor from Limbuli in Mulanje district, has donated uniforms to underprivileged students at Chitedze Primary School.
Isaac, who owns a popular tailoring shop in town, was moved to action after witnessing numerous students attending school in tattered clothing.

Isaac revealed to this Online publication that seeing young students struggling to attend school in dilapidated attire motivated him to take action. “I thought to myself, ‘what can I do to help?’ and decided to use my tailoring skills to make a difference,” he said.
With the help of his team, Isaac designed and sewed uniforms for the needy students.
Charles Nkhoma, headteacher at Chitedze Primary School, praised Isaac’s generosity, citing him as a shining example of community service. “Isaac’s donation is a testament to the impact individuals can have when they choose to support those in need,” Nkhoma noted.
The donated uniforms will benefit numerous students who previously struggled to afford proper attire.
